However the whole KFC\DHL debacle is breathtaking in its incompetence....

Chicken Delivery contract taken away from specialist food transportation/logistics company Bidvest and given to DHL (a non food specialist) who promptly find out they cant deliver!
This must be costing KFC millions all to save a few quid on a contract? Someone in the bid team needs a major kick up the arse.

Apparently KFC realised about 3 weeks ago they'd made a major boo boo with DHL, but it was too late - Bidvest lost 300 staff and closed a distribution depot because of it.....
